      Abstract
      aims to determine the profile of Lovebird breeders in Gamping District, Sleman Regency, to know how to breed Lovebird birds in Gamping District, Sleman Regency and to find out the costs, acceptance and benefits of Lovebird breeders in Gamping District, Sleman Regency, to know how to breed Lovebird birds in Gamping District, Sleman Regency and to determine the costs, revenues and benefits of Lovebird breeders in Gamping District, Sleman Regency . Retrieval of respondents by the Snowball method was 30 farmers. Data was collected by observing and interviewing the respondent directly to be analyzed descriptively. The results showed that the age of Lovebird breeders was productive, namely between 30 - 60 years and the education level of farmers educated from high school to university level. Based on the principal work of livestock farmers, most of the Lovebird breeders as a side business. The total costs incurred by farmers in the Lovebird livestock business for 2 years is Rp. 31,015,725,. Proceeds from Lovebird bird farms are obtained from the sale of Lovebird puppies and broodstock rejects. The total revenue received by farmers is Rp. 64,879,207,. From the results of the study the total profit received for 2 years is Rp. 33,887,082,.
